Kato_Zenamara Posted October 8, 2011 Report Share Posted October 8, 2011 This IS the realistic section, which is meant for cards that could actually be printed, and are to be treated that way. Printing a card that does the exact same thing as an already existing card, but has no cost, doesn't take up an actual spell/trap zone, works with stuff like malefics and other cards that require field spells, and supports a generally more flexible play style, isn't very realistic. It [i]should[/i] have a cost or drawback. The "summon the level 2 or lower monster" isn't very usable. Sure, there are a few targetable cards that see a good amount of use in the current game, but they wouldn't run this, nor would this be a reason to run them. Add a 500 lp payment per your standby phase and I'd be game. But this is just a spammable, more easily playable skill drain.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
